Rearrange the following in the correct order of involvement in electrical impulse movement:
$(i)$ Synaptic knob
$(ii)$ Dendrites
$(iii)$ Cell body
$(iv)$ Axon terminal
$(v)$ Axon

(A) The electrical impulse travels through a neuron in the following sequence:
$1$. Dendrites $(ii)$: These receive the signal.
$2$. Cell body $(iii)$: The signal is processed here.
$3$. Axon $(v)$: The impulse travels along the axon.
$4$. Axon terminal $(iv)$: The signal reaches the end of the axon.
$5$. Synaptic knob $(i)$: The signal reaches the terminal bulb to trigger neurotransmitter release.
Therefore,the correct order is $(ii) \rightarrow (iii) \rightarrow (v) \rightarrow (iv) \rightarrow (i)$.
